Story

It is with great sadness that we announce the death of Dr. Philip Huynh, a devoted and much loved husband, father and grandfather who passed away peacefully at home on October 25, 2020. 

Philip lived an eventful life - a Vietnam War veteran and concentration camp survivor, a refugee, a GP for the NHS, a loving father of three, an affectionate grandfather, and a close and caring husband to his wife Anna. 

In his retirement, Philip travelled extensively with his family. He enjoyed reading, listening to country music, exercising, building and decorating toy soldiers, war documentaries and John Wayne movies, watching crime drama re-runs in the afternoon with a glass of port, and family BBQs.

Philip’s memory will live on in the hearts and minds off all those who knew and loved him.

About the charity

The Roman Catholic Diocese of Arundel and Brighton was formed in 1965 by Pope Paul VI. Our diocesan church family, in the care of Bishop Richard Moth, includes 74 parishes across Sussex and Surrey with 91 priests and 81 schools. We are very grateful for your support.
